Output 9e77166e026403e5569ef42223de6e7a81e08c2c2e1b0dc2cc7fe85c0ad291ec:5

value
20774376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ffc3f48a75d1b203688279b6554bb1dcf60d0d11 OP_EQUAL
address
MXDXHZB8pHQj2g9NNxMDBnfHCtZ1AxAvzq
transaction
9e77166e026403e5569ef42223de6e7a81e08c2c2e1b0dc2cc7fe85c0ad291ec
spent
true